This thesis aims to discuss the syntactic and semantic features of Chinese focusmarker shenzhi. The theories are mainly based on Chomsky’s (1981,1995)Government and Binding and Bare Phrase Theory, Karttunen&Peters’(1979) ScopeTheory and Rooth’s (1985) Lexical Theory. We focus on the following three researchquestions in this thesis:1. What is the syntactic status of shenzhi in shenzhi+VP construction?2. What is the information structure of the shenzhi+VP construction?3. What are the semantic properties of shenzhi in Mandarin Chinese?This thesis analyzes the syntactic status of shenzhi in shenzhi+VP construction.Shenzhi+VP does not involve any movement, the focus is in the scope of shenzhi. Inshenzhi+VP construction, shenzhi takes the head of the Focus Phrase. Shenzhi has tom-command the focus. Meanwhile, it further explains the reasons of the acceptabilityof shenzhi+dou+VP, whereas the unacceptability of lian+dou+VP. Lian, as apronominal focus marker, can not be independently used without any objectmovement. Shenzhi differs from lian in that it can be followed by a wide range ofcategories, including dou. In the structure shenzhi+dou+VP, dou is the head of the FP;shenzhi, as an Adverb Phrase, is an adjunct of the [Spec FP]. The focus markingdevice for shenzhi+VP structure needs intonational stress. The focus can not bemarked directly by syntactic measures. We argue that the focus in this structurebelongs to the information focus. The focus is the most prominent item in the sentence,so it carries the feature [+prominent].The focus marked by shenzhi exerts scalar properties. Shenzhi can appear both inpositive and negative environments. The scalar implicature is related to theenvironment where shenzhi occurs. In positive environment, the focus stays at thebottom of the scale. In negative environment, the focus invariably stays at the top of ascale no matter it is in the embedded clause or the matrix clause. Thus, it is claimedthat the Scope Theory is more suitable for shenzhi.The syntactic structures of shenzhi offer possibility to make comparison andcontrast between shenzhi and Greek akomi ke. These two focus markers take additivemeaning, but there are still many differences in their semantic interpretations.Through the crosslinguistic analysis, the logic representation of shenzhi is achieved.
